As I mentioned before Kate had found the house before we came over to visit in the July!

She had taken some great photos and with very little research to the area, I knew that I wanted to buy it! The size was great, 4k of land for the horses with its own stream running through it! No more problems with getting a big truck up the hill every few weeks.

The house is based in a small village called Musina or Мусина in cyrillic. We are only 24km from the town of Veliko Tarnavo, if you click on the link it will open a you tube video which is quite cute if you ignore the music!

The downside for this area is we are so far from the airport compared to living near Alicante. Sofia is at least a 3 hr drive away and any other airports that can be used liked, Varna or Bucharest! Great thing about the area is the rock climbing for Rich and clients and amazing riding for the horses right from our back door!

The plan at this stage is that the house will be our summer home! So all designs are based on summer living....

WHY BULGARIA?

We have been living on the Costa Blanca, running our climbers hostel The Orange House, for 13 years. From the months of May to September however, the climbers leave, we change over the decor and the house becomes a large rental Villa. Apart from cleaning and handing over keys, there really is no reason to stay in Spain.

Why would anyone want to stay in Spain over the summer anyway? Way, way too hot unless you are on holiday and are happy to live on the beach and hide in the shade! In the past we always managed to escape back to the UK or the Alps and enjoy cooler temps and be able to be outdoors!

However, we took an odd turn in our lives 3 years ago when we discovered our love of horses, so leaving them behind for long periods of time was not an option! That is when I started to look at other areas in Europe to move lock stock and barrel during the summer months! I never imagined for a minute that we would be moving so far east and that it would be a full time move and not just for the summer as we first thought!

Again you might say "why Bulgaria?" I am going to lay the blame 100% on a mate called Kate, horse mad, Podenco mad, change your mind every minute mad! Actually shall we just say she is mad full stop! But, she really is not mad when she suggested we came and had a look around and she was 100% right when she said that after a few visits we would want to be based here and not Spain! I hate to admit that she was correct and after only a few trips that is exactly what we are planning to do!

The view across to the mountains! 

We went over to check out the area last July 2015, Kate had already found us a house, I knew just from the photos that we would buy it! Rich took a bit of convincing and we did spend a week looking around at other places, but nothing came close and we went back in the October to pay the money!

I will admit now that the grand total of  3500 euros really helped make our mind up, as even once we have done it up and made it livable if it all goes tits up and we come back to Spain we have not really lost too much!
